Knowledge Representation

The method of encoding information about the world into a format that a computer system can utilize.

Expanded definition

Knowledge representation is a key aspect of artificial intelligence that involves representing information about the world in a form understandable by machines. This can include semantic networks, frames, ontologies, and rules. Effective knowledge representation is essential for enabling reasoning, problem-solving, and intelligent behavior in AI systems.
